It is the believe of many people especially men that women are so hard to understand, as a result of this many people (males) finds it difficult to relate with women in an effective way.

Well, the truth I will tell you is that women are not that hard/difficult to understand or relate with. All you need to do is take time to study them and understand their body language. This article will help you to understand the women’s body language you don’t known and their meanings.

1. Pacifying gestures: while talking to a woman and she is showing some gestures like playing with her hair, jewelries or touching her neck often, this can mean she is stressed or nervous. Some people think it is because she is attracted to them, well, that may be true in some cases but most women do this because she is distressed, nervous or not comfortable talking with you and you may need to end the conversation to make her feel at ease again.

2. Smiling: a woman’s smile can be difficult to understand, when a woman is smiling or she keeps a smiling face doesn’t always mean she is friendly or happy with what you are saying, some women smile when they are nervous. Most women smile in an inappropriate time which makes it difficult to understand them. You may need to pay attention to other body languages before you can understand a woman’s smile.

3. Nodding: women nods often, when a woman nods, it doesn’t always mean she agrees with you, her nod may be to encourage you to speak on, or showing that she’s listening to you. Most men misunderstand a woman’s nod, it doesn’t necessarily mean she agrees with you.



4. Leaning forward: most women lean forward when they are involved in an intense conversation, they carry their back away from the chair and lean forward when they are really interested in the conversation or they are really into the conversation.

5. Hand gestures: it is common for women to talk with their hands, this happen when they get emotionally invested in a conversation. When a woman express a lot with her hand, it can simply mean she is emotional about the topic of discussion especially when she raise her hands above her shoulder, she is not in control of the situation but if she’s above the situation, she will raise her hand moderately.
